In Reply to: 2010 john deere gas posted by a. cosh on February 07, 2010 at 06:27:03:
I had a 2010 gas so this is from personal experience. The hydraulic system is not reliable. There is a screen filter in the bottom right side of the transmission that sometimes gets clogged up. Sometimes cleaning it out good and replacing the oil works, sometimes a new filter is required. The transmission gearshift lever system sometimes gives trouble. Everything has to be adjusted just right for all the gears to engage.
The power steering system works of the same pump as the rest of the system. There is a priority valve which gives precedence to the power steering and sometimes there is not enough hydraulic power to go around. I was using it with a FEL and that probably led to problems.
I never had any experience with a diesel so I really can't compar them.
Having said that, the 2010 did have good operator comfort. The gearshift on the dash helped with having an uncluttered platform.
